一个与众不同的块,基点不变重定义块,位置会变,高手进
本帖最后由 wuzhenif 于 2023-9-5 22:56 编辑一个块,炸散后通过命令行(-block)重定义这个块,基点还用原来的基点,图元还用炸散后的图元,这个块的基点没有变化,但是在图中的位置会变,也就是这个块内的图元与基点的相对位置变了,请高手解答这是什么原因?这个与众不同的块在附件中,请自行测试
测试方法是:先把这个块复制一个,然后把原来那个块炸散,然后命令行-block重定义这个块,基点就用原来的基点坐标,图元就用炸散后的图元,然后观察复制的那个块,看看块的基点以及基点和块内图元的相对位置是否改变。
不用看,大概率UCS闹的
没毛病,测试完毕 ssyfeng 发表于 2023-9-6 08:44
没毛病,测试完毕
一看就没认真测试,正常的块,炸散基点不变,重做快位置并不会变化,这个块不同 本帖最后由 gaics 于 2023-9-6 11:06 编辑
块内给了一个基点参数,基点参数会改变块的基点显示位置,如图箭头所指的点。
你给的直线参考点并不是块的实际基点,感觉是个bug。重新建块不应该影响到原有的块,你说的基点会变,不知是什么操作触发了更新显示。
你可以测试一下,在块内做简单编辑,然后保存块。再看块的位置是否发生变化。 本帖最后由 wuzhenif 于 2023-9-6 11:37 编辑
gaics 发表于 2023-9-6 10:26
块内给了一个基点参数,基点参数会改变块的基点显示位置,如图箭头所指的点。
你给的直线参考点并不是块的 ...
是的,这个块的基点在块编辑器里面与图元的相对位置,和在外面是不同的,不知道什么原因,除非把这个基点删了,重新定义一个基点,才能恢复正常。
页:
[1]